Sugar Minott's Musical Legacy
Let's take a moment to really appreciate the monumental impact Sugar Minott had on the world of music. As we touched upon earlier, he wasn't just any artist; he was a trailblazer. Born Lincoln Barrington Minott in Kingston, Jamaica, in 1956, he rose to prominence in the late 1970s and became a central figure in the evolution of reggae and dancehall. His career spanned decades, producing an incredible body of work that continues to inspire and entertain. Sugar Minott's music is characterized by its soulful melodies, his distinctive vocal delivery – often described as smooth, yet powerful – and his lyrical prowess. He was a master storyteller, weaving tales of love, social justice, and everyday life in Jamaica into his songs. Some of his most iconic tracks include "Ska-Boo-Da-Bim", "Divide and Rule", and "Never Give You Up", each showcasing his versatility and artistic depth. He was also known for his innovative approach to music production, often working with renowned producers and experimenting with different sounds, which helped push the boundaries of the genre.
Beyond his solo career, Sugar Minott was also a mentor and a source of inspiration for many younger artists. He was instrumental in nurturing new talent, providing opportunities and guidance to aspiring musicians. His influence extended to the development of dancehall music, a more energetic and often faster-paced style of reggae that emerged in the late 70s and 80s. Sugar Minott's contributions were crucial in popularizing this sound both in Jamaica and internationally. He was a consistent performer, touring extensively and bringing his unique brand of reggae to audiences across the globe. His live shows were legendary, filled with an infectious energy and a genuine connection with his fans. The respect he commanded within the music community was immense, and he was often referred to as "King Sugar" or "The Chief" by his peers and admirers. His passing in 2010 was a great loss to the music world, but his legacy lives on through his extensive discography and the countless artists he inspired. Unpacking the Surname: Commonality and Coincidence
So, to circle back to our main question: is Josh Minott related to Sugar Minott? Based on available public information and the general understanding of celebrity connections, there is no direct, confirmed familial relationship between basketball player Josh Minott and the legendary reggae artist Sugar Minott. The surname 'Minott' is not extraordinarily rare, and it's perfectly plausible for two individuals from different backgrounds and geographical locations to share it without being related. This is a common phenomenon, especially as individuals gain prominence in their respective fields. It’s a classic case of coincidence, where a shared name sparks a natural curiosity. Think about it, how many people named 'Williams' are out there? Serena and Venus are related, but there are countless other Williamses who are not. The same principle applies here.
